6 Ways to Fix Discord Overlay Not Working Error

Method #1 Reboot Your System

This may sound old school, this is just like an exilir for most technical problems and we never know it could fix your problem! So all you need to do is close all your applications and running games and discord app itself and shutdown your system.

And after rebooting your system there are maximum chances that your problem is solved.

Method #2 Enabling The Option

Use the following steps to enable the option-

Step 1: Open the discord app.

Step 2: Go to the user settings, a button for which is located on the bottom left on the Discord windows of the app for desktop.

Step 3: From left navigation pane choose Overlay.

Step 4: Make sure that the Enable In-game overlay option is selected.

Step 5: You need to save the settings and reopen the game. Using the hotkey dedicated you can enable the overlay in a game. The default hotkey in the latest version of discord for enabling the in-game overlay is Shift + `.

Method #3 Enable Or Change The Hotkey

Sometimes, the hotkey is not assigned to the Discord overlay. Also, the hotkey which is assigned can interfere with other hotkeys in the app. This may also be the reason behind the Discord overlay problem. The following steps may fix this problem

Step 1: Click on the Start menu and open the Discord app. If the app is not displayed under the Start menu, then open C drive. In C drive, under Program Files select Discord. Find the executable file under it and run it.

Step 2: Click on the gear-like symbol on the Discord app window. It opens up the User Settings menu.

Step 3: From the left pane, select the Overlay option. In the right pane, you will find the assigned hotkey. Assign a new hotkey according to your wish.

Step 4: Save the new settings and now open your game.

Step 5: You can open your game by using the newly assigned hotkey.

Method #4 Change The Overlay Position

Sometimes, it is possible that you have accidentally moved Overlay off the screen. So as Overlay will not be at its exact position, error may come. Apply the following steps to change the Overlay position:

Step 1: Close the game that you are playing. Open Discord App from Start menu.

Step 2: Press Ctrl + Shift + I key combination. A new java script console window is displayed.

Step 3: Click on the icon on the java script console window.

Step 4: Choose the Application option from the list.

Step 5: Double click Local Storage option from the left pane. Various options will be displayed.

Step 6: Right-click on Overlay Store or OverlayStoreV2 and select Delete option.

Step 7: Close the game and application. Start them once again. This procedure will set the Overlay position to default.

Method #5 Run The Discord App As An Administrator

Many times administrator privileges are required to run the Discord app. You can fix this issue by following the given steps:

Step 1: On your Desktop, right-click the shortcut icon of Discord and select Properties option. You can also find Discord option from the Start menu.

Step 2: A window will be displayed. Navigate through the Compatibility tab. Check the option Run this program as an administrator.

Step 3: Now click on the Apply and OK button to save the changes.

Step 4: Restart to your game.

Method #6 Reinstall Or Update The Discord App

Chances are corrupt or missing configuration files also create trouble. Also, new updates of the app may be needed sometime.

So it is better to install the app again. To do this, first, uninstall the old app. Steps for uninstalling and reinstalling the Discord app are:

Uninstalling the App

Step 1: From the keyboard, press Windows + R to open the Run dialog box. Type Control and press Enter key.

Step 2: The Control Panel will be opened. View Control Panel by Category. Click on Uninstall a program.

Step 3: Double click on Discord to uninstall it.

Step 4: Restart your system.

Reinstalling the App

Once the old app is uninstalled, you need to install it again. The procedure for installing the Discord app is given as follow:

Step 1: Download the latest Discord app from the official website.

Step 2: Install it through a download installer.

Step 3: Reboot the system again.
